The Challenges and Value of Architecture
This chapter discusses the challenges and value of architecture as a profession, exploring the intersection of scientific and artistic aspects and how architects struggle to describe their work. It also acknowledges the compromises and limitations architects face, emphasizing the need for skills to sell themselves and work within constraints.
